3.1.2 Processor Population Rules
When using a single processor configuration, you must install the processor into the processor
socket labeled CPU_1. A terminator is not required in the second processor socket when a
single processor is used.
When two processors are installed, the following population rules apply:
Both processors must be from the same processor family.
Both processors must have the same Intel
®
QuickPath Interconnect speed.
Both processors must have the same cache size.
You can mix processors with different speeds in a system, given the prior rules are met.
If this condition is detected, all processor speeds are set to the lowest common
denominator (highest common speed) and an error is reported.
You can mix processor stepping within a common processor family as long as it is listed
in the processor specification updates published by Intel Corporation.
